Background Noise is the brainchild of an Arizonan pianist - Riley - and a Californian punk rock bassist - Jimmy. The mission is simple -- to put the most understated instruments in rock/punk/most music in the spotlight.
The first song they composed as a team was a rendition of "¿Viva La Gloria? (Little Girl)" by Green Day off the album 21st Century Breakdown, using only the pianist's by-ear playing and heavily modified bass tabs.
Thus far, they haven't composed an original song, but it's in the works.
